<p>About <a href="http://na.oceana.org/">Oceana</a>:
Oceana, founded in 2001, is the largest international organization focused solely on ocean conservation. With offices in North America, Central America, South America and Europe, Oceana builds strategic and directed campaigns that will help return our oceans to former levels of abundance. They believe in the importance of science in identifying problems and solutions. Their scientists work closely with their teams of economists, lawyers and advocates to achieve tangible results for the oceans.</p>

<p><em>Efflorescence</em> is a series of lumen prints by Shannon Amidon 
inspired by her interest in blending artistic renderings of nature and 
old world photographic techniques. Camera-less images are created by 
exposing botanical specimens and photographic paper to varying levels of
 sunlight, time, and temperature, creating unique and ethereal images 
that transcend the specimens' natural color, shape, and form.</p>

                            </a>llingsley<br /><br /><i>Transfiguration</i> is a collection of three dimensional art is an expression of <a href="http://www.studiosandi.com/">Sandi Billingsley</a>'s faith that "we humans can live in luxury while being environmentally responsible." Transfiguration is essentially the art of changing the properties of an object. In this case it refers to the changing of garbage into art. <br />&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p; This series is made entirely from rescued materials. The core is made of Styrofoam collected from shipping packages, friends and&nbsp; dumpsters.&nbsp; Sandi then applies a combination of old paint clothes, junk mail, phone books --- basically anything with natural fibers headed for the trash. Dipping these flexible materials in non-toxic glue gives them strength to hold interesting shapes. Finally, the piece is finished with "Aqua Brand" textures and paint which are non-toxic.&nbsp; The result is an environmentally friendly piece of art.<br /><br /><br /><a href="http://www.kaleidgallery.com/assets_c/2010/01/Relativematter_web-21.html" onclick="window.open('http://www.kaleidgallery.com/assets_c/2010/01/Relativematter_web-21.html','popup','width=380,height=370,scrollbars=no,resizable=no,toolbar=no,directories=no,location=no,menubar=no,status=no,left=0,top=0'); return false"><img src="http://www.kaleidgallery.com/assets_c/2010/01/Relativematter_web-thumb-320x311-21.jpg" alt="Relativematter_web.jpg" class="mt-image-none" width="290" height="282" /></a><br />art by Mark Damrel<br /><br /><i>Relative Matter</i> is a series of paintings by <a href="http://www.flickr.com/people/mark_damrel/">Mark Damrel</a> inspired by the hardships he encountered on his journey into fatherhood.&nbsp; "Years went by with little to no hope.&nbsp; I started to get used to the fact that I would never have a family, and then it happened."&nbsp; <br />&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p; In groupings of mixed media paintings on wood and paper, he explores the themes of childhood memories, despair, hope and joy.&nbsp; <br /><br />Meet the artists at the opening reception on <b>Friday, February 5th</b>, 7-9pm, featuring live music by INFM, and Tyler Boyd.<br /><br />This reception is part of the <a href="http://www.southfirstfridays.com/">South First Fridays</a> art walk and is free and open to the public.<br /><br />In addition to the feature exhibitions, peruse the art of 60 regional artists work in the gallery. <br /><br />Gallery Hours:<br />Tuesday - Friday, Noon - 7pm<br />Saturday, Noon - 5pm<br /><br />KALEID Gallery<br />88 South Fourth Street<br />Downtown San Jose<br />http://www.KALEIDgallery.com<br />408-947-1785<br />]]>

<p><strong>A Grand and Unusual Puppet show by Dax </strong>
Dax's show is original songs on accordion and wine glasses in an american folk style, paired with three short puppetry pieces that unfold from three plywood suitcases. The theme of the puppet shows is of making something out of nothing, and are on the more experimental side of the craft. He has been performing shows on the west coast since 2001 with Corpus Callosum. From 2007-2008 he performed puppetry with the renowned Chicago Blair Thomas &amp; Co. Chamber Puppet Theater.</p>

<p>"As with his songs, there is no showmanship, legerdemain, pretense or fanfare in the presentation of this non-traditional puppetry. On stage, Dax has a deceptively casual manner - meanwhile, glowing stars pop out of suitcases of their own accord, and apparitions rise out of heaps of cardboard and collapse just as quickly. Nothing is hidden in the straight-forward construction of the puppets and apparatuses, and yet each piece unfolds a moment of magic that is as moving as it is direct. These shows cleverly present the fascination that has been lost to us since childhood, though you wouldn't imagine how simply it was achieved."</p>
